How to bring a removed page back?

I read I (as an dmin) can bring removed pages back, but how? I've been looking everywhere, but can't find it, so my best guess: I'm overlooking something very obvious probably.

A member with special priviliges removed a page a few days ago, and we'd like to restore it if possible.

When you delete a page, there's an option that aks if you want the page permanently deleted (that is, all versions removed from the database). If that option was selected, then I think you may be out of luck — the page is gone. cry

Well, if they only deleted specific version of the page, you can rollback the history to a prior version. On the tiki-page_history.php of the page in question and select R to rollback to a specific version.

Hey Lex, I think you are out of luck on this one.

Do a Page name search for the page. You can do this from a search box or from the list pages page. If your page does not show up then I would say it is gone. The page back up and restore function only works if the history is not removed. If the page is removed and the "remove all pages in history" check box is checked then the page will be gone.

You can also use the calendar to show the page changes. If the page was deleated and not the history it will say something like "pageX page removed version 2" And, oh no, if it says "pagex page removed" well then it is time to hope you can use your backups if the page is important.

There are several safe gaurds you can do to prevent this.

  • check the setting in the admin wiki page.


"Never delete versions younger than days"

Change this to some older date so that new revisions might be removed but the older version remains.

  • set delete perms for your users.


Only allow some people be allowed to delete pages.

  • Set up watchs for pages changes. Make TW send you an e-mail with page changes etc and you will have the page in your mail box if you need to replace it. Now this can be a bit of a box filler if you have a lot of site changes. However, if you set it up right you could have different folk get the backups for thier own depts and have them resposible for page deletions.
